I've grown to love the Zelda series, but (Story time!) not long after OoT(Ocarina) came out my brother was playing it on N64 while I watched and "advised". It was a used copy. There were two empty files, and one that seemed to have been hacked somehow.

So we played a certain ways into an empty, far enough that we got into Hyrule Castle Town, at least. And then we tried the Third File, which was seriously messed up(some items were present, others weren't, no medallions, Navi kept urging us to go visit the Deku Tree - yet this was Adult Link, who should've long passed that stage). Anyway, "Cool, Link is a grown-up! Let's go outside of the Temple of Time and talk to people!"

And, well... if you've played the game, you know what I'm talking about. The town is gray and dull, there is an evil castle hanging in the sky, the colorful bustling crowds are gone, and in their place are the Redeads.

Red-brown emaciated shambling corpses with faces like wooden masks. They scream when they see you - in this instance the scream doesn't paralyze you, but still, get close enough, or get surrounded, and one jumps on you and you have to buttonmash frantically to break free, which gives another the chance...

I didn't get the "rape" connotations until I was older, but it was bad enough imagining a zombie latched onto your back chewing on your shoulders. Nightmare Fuel, oh very yes.

Neither of us was more than ten... we stopped playing Zelda of any kind for about a year after that. There's a lot of Nightmare Fuel in that game, really. Even so, it was a great one. Truly fantastic.
